Updating Your Web Site EfficientlyMany new webmasters, and even seasoned web designers, create web sites that are very inefficient in regard to updates. Updating your site keeps visitors coming back day in and day out, while at the same time giving search engines plenty to index. Yet if the task of updating your web site is not an efficient one, hundreds and thousands of hours can be lost. Using simple solutions, such as content management systems, the efficiency of updating a web site can be improved dramatically. Search Engine Basics: Incoming Links, PageRank, and RelevancyAn incoming link is a link from someone else's site to your site. To search engines, especially Google, this acts like a vote for your site. It means that someone else thinks your site is worth linking to. In general, the more incoming links you have, the better you'll rank in search engines. Google PageRankGoogle assigns each page a number called PageRank, and uses this in determining how high your page is ranked for any given search term. You can see the PageRank of any page by installing the Google Toolbar and enabling the advanced features. |
